PCIe Retimers Market Analysis:
The global PCIe Retimers Market was valued at 183 million in 2024 and is projected to reach US$ 2151 million by 2031, at a CAGR of 43.3% during the forecast period.
PCIe Retimers Market Overview
A retime is a digital and analog device. It receives the signal and extracts the digital part of it, then it regenerates it as a separately trained link, in both directions. Therefore, the noise (and other imperfections such as jitter), that was originally present, will be eliminated, it is like a fresh start from the re-generated signal.
A PCIe Retimer is a specialized integrated circuit (IC) designed to enhance and extend Peripheral Component Interconnect Express (PCIe) signal transmission. These devices are essential in complex hardware configurations where PCIe lanes must traverse through connectors, cables, backplanes, or mid-planes, which can introduce signal degradation due to interconnect discontinuities and inter-symbol interference (ISI).
Key Function:
PCIe Retimers receive a degraded PCIe signal, clean and equalize it, and retransmit a fresh signal as if originating from a native PCIe device—thus preserving signal integrity over long or complex physical paths.

Competitive Landscape
The PCIe retimer market is highly competitive and technology-intensive, dominated by a few key players. The top six companies control about 92% of the market, backed by strong patent portfolios and advanced product lines.
Leading Companies:
Astera Labs
Renesas Electronics
Parade Technologies
Texas Instruments
Microchip Technology
Montage Technology

Market Challenges
Rapid Evolution of PCIe Standards
Constant upgrades in PCIe standards push manufacturers to frequently update their product offerings, posing challenges in R&D and product lifecycle.Heat Dissipation and Power Consumption
High-performance retimers often face thermal and power efficiency issues, especially in densely packed server boards.Competition from Alternative Technologies
Technologies like redrivers and optical interconnects can offer alternative solutions for certain use-cases, increasing competitive pressure.
